Description:2015 repress; originally released in 2011. John Holt was one of the finest and most versatile voices to come out of Jamaica, whether fronting The Paragons or as a solo artist. Born in Kingston, Holt was a child prodigy who began his career as a regular voice on the talent contests run by Vera Johns across Jamaica. He cut his first single, I Cried a Tear/Forever I'll Stay, in 1963, and sang many duets with various singers of the day, including Rum Bumper with Alton Ellis. The period from 1965 to 1970 was John Holt's paragon era, during which he also ran solo with such hits as Fancy Make Up, A Love I Can Feel, and Let's Build Our Dreams. CD includes three tracks not included on the LP version.
Tracks 15 and 16 are CD Bonus Tracks. Manufactured under Licence from E. Lee. Made in the U.K. Studios include: Channel 1, Harry J's, Randy's Studio 17. Sources: Track 1: Rock with me Track 2: I'll never be lonely Track 3: Get it while its hot Track 4: You must believe me Track 5: Since I fell for you Track 6: A man needs a woman Track 7: Lets kiss and say goodbye Track 8: Jam in the street Track 9: In the springtime Track 10: Forgot to say I love you Track 11: Let's do it Track 12: No man is an island Track 13: Wasted days and wasted nights Track 14: You are wrong Track 15: Fancy make up Track 16: Walk away

John Holt is regarded as one of reggae's most beloved singers, known both for his tenure with The Paragons and for his long solo career, during which he helped define the lovers rock and roots sound with his silky, emotional vocals. Across decades he scored numerous hits, became a mainstay of Jamaican music charts and gained a loyal international following for his unique blend of romantic ballads and conscious themes. His songs have been covered and versioned countless times in reggae and beyond, underscoring his status as a cornerstone of Caribbean music.
